Clostridium Perfringens: A Common Bacterial Cause of Infection

Clostridium perfringens is a prevalent bacterium known for causing a wide range of infections in humans. It is one of the leading causes of food poisoning worldwide, and its ability to thrive in various environments makes it a persistent health concern.

This bacterium belongs to the Clostridium genus, which consists of several species, with C. perfringens being one of the most notable. It is a gram-positive, anaerobic bacterium that forms endospores, allowing it to survive in harsh conditions.

Clostridium perfringens infections can occur in different parts of the body, leading to various health problems. Some common infections caused by this bacterium include:

  • Gas gangrene: A severe infection that affects the muscles and soft tissues
  • Necrotizing enteritis: An infection that causes inflammation and tissue death in the intestines
  • Food poisoning: Consumption of contaminated food or beverages can result in gastrointestinal symptoms

The bacteria produce toxins that contribute to the virulence of the infection. Notably, the production of the C. perfringens enterotoxin is responsible for the symptoms associated with food poisoning.

The Role of Clostridium Perfringens in Food Poisoning

Food poisoning caused by Clostridium perfringens is a significant concern, especially in settings where food is improperly handled or stored. The bacteria can multiply rapidly in foods such as meat, poultry, and gravies when left at improper temperatures.

When ingested, the enterotoxin produced by C. perfringens affects the lining of the intestines, leading to symptoms like abdominal cramps and diarrhea. These symptoms usually appear within 6 to 24 hours after consuming the contaminated food and typically resolve within 24 to 48 hours.

Diagnosis and Testing for Clostridium Perfringens Infections

In order to diagnose Clostridium perfringens infections, several laboratory tests are available to confirm the presence of the bacterium and identify the specific infection. These tests help healthcare professionals determine the appropriate treatment and management strategies.

Laboratory tests for Clostridium perfringens infections:

Test Purpose
Culture To isolate and identify Clostridium perfringens bacteria from samples, such as blood, stool, or tissue.
PCR (Polymerase Chain Reaction) To detect and amplify specific DNA sequences of Clostridium perfringens for diagnosis.
Toxin Testing To identify the presence of toxins produced by Clostridium perfringens, such as alpha toxin, which is responsible for the symptoms of infection.
Antimicrobial Susceptibility Testing To determine the susceptibility of Clostridium perfringens bacteria to various antibiotics, guiding appropriate treatment decisions.

Clostridium Perfringens in the Food Industry

In the food industry, Clostridium perfringens poses a significant risk of food poisoning. This bacterium, commonly found in the environment and human intestines, can contaminate food if proper food handling procedures are not followed. It is important for food establishments to understand the potential sources of contamination and implement measures to prevent the spread of this bacterium.

See also  Clostridium Perfringens Colony Traits Guide

One of the main sources of Clostridium perfringens contamination is improper temperature control. This bacterium thrives in environments with temperatures between 20°C and 50°C (68°F and 122°F). If cooked food is left at room temperature for an extended period, it provides an ideal breeding ground for Clostridium perfringens to multiply and produce toxins that can cause food poisoning.

Another source of contamination is inadequate cooking. Insufficient cooking temperatures may not kill the bacterium, allowing it to survive and cause infection when consumed. It is crucial for food establishments to ensure that all food, especially meat and poultry, is cooked thoroughly to the recommended internal temperature to eliminate any potential bacteria.

Proper storage practices also play a crucial role in preventing Clostridium perfringens food poisoning. Food should be stored at safe temperatures to inhibit bacterial growth. Refrigeration at temperatures below 4°C (40°F) is essential for maintaining food safety. Additionally, leftover food should be cooled rapidly and stored properly to minimize the risk of bacterial contamination.
